Originally Posted by DezodDon
I would agree if this was a Tubular manifold but log manifolds made from Sch 40 304 SS are damn near bomb proof.......however. If you do not use the supplied spring bolts that are supplied with the kit you then remove the area that is supposed to pivot. Without this pivot point you have an exhaust that now acts like a giant pry bar.

I hate to say it but 9 times out of 10 if there is a problem it's usually a user error. Those of you that think that a tubular weld elbow manifold is stronger are completely wrong. Properly designed tubular manifolds have the capability to make more power on higher boost levels but they are heavier and much more prone to cracking. For proof of this do a search on Honda-Tech. That community has been turboing cars longer than any other sport compact. Big names like full race, AFI, Omni fab etc. All of them fail and they all have problems over time. It's the nature of the beast sometimes. While log manifolds may not make the most power they are hands down the most reliable due to their simple construction next to a cast manifold.

Due to improper installation of the downpipe and it's install kit, lacking these essential pieces (such as the donut gasket and spring loaded bolt assembly) which allow for pivot, movement, and preservation of similar geometry to OEM; you made the manifold the pivitol point when the engine torques. Add 3000+ lbs of force rocking, twisting and pulling on any manifold, and it will break.
The donut gasket and spring loaded bolts, where clearly not installed on your kit, which you sent pictures to me and I forwarded to Don and he posted above. The hard mount on the downpipe and s-pipe made the entire assembly stress and fail the way it did.
